Connecting the Dots | Ep. 3 Ty Locke

Episode 3 of the Connecting the Dots podcast from Amici.Art with Ty Locke.

In this episode George meets emerging artist Ty Locke in the studio in Mexico City where Ty was on a residency, making a new body of work for the Material Art Fair. The conversation runs through Ty's upbringing and his discovery of art as a way of expressing himself, queer identity and his subversive use of everyday objects in his sculptures.

About Connecting The Dots

Connecting the Dots is an Amici podcast presented by George Mingozzi-Marsh. Each episode George meets with an artist to chat about their community, collaborations and how these connections continue to shape the artist they are today.

How it works for Galleries

Amici brings together galleries from different parts of the world, encouraging them to collaborate, share resources, and expand their reach. Through shared exhibitions hosted online and promoted via Amici.Art, galleries can connect with a global audience, enabling clients to browse and purchase artworks directly.

No Sign-up Fees
Galleries only pay a £50 administration fee once a Host and Visitor gallery are successfully paired.

Shared Risk and Profit
Operating costs and profits are shared between Host and Visiting galleries, with Amici taking a 5% commission from each gallery on sales made through the platform only.

Benefits for All Participants

  • Host Gallery: Reduce operating costs, diversify programming, and gain access to new, international audiences.
  • Visiting Gallery: Showcase your artists globally while leveraging the infrastructure of local galleries, avoiding the hectic, costly art fair experience.

Inclusivity and Fair Practice
Amici is committed to promoting diversity and inclusivity, with all galleries adhering to our Code of Conduct.
